Q.: |
What is
InteCel? |
|
A.: |
InteCel is expanded foam PVC sheet extrusion with an integral
hard skin surface. |

Q.: |
What are InteCel’s main features? |
|
A.: |
Wood-like working characteristics. Light weight. Impervious to
moisture. Requires no sealing or priming. Chemical resistance. Fire retardancy. |

Q.: |
In what sizes does InteCel come? |
|
A.: |
InteCel comes in sheet 4’x8’ but custom lengths up to
22 ft can
be made upon request with minimum required. |
| |
|
|
Q.: |
In what thickness is InteCel available? |
|
A.: |
10mm (3/8”), 13mm(1/2”), 16mm(5/8”), 19mm(3/4”), 25mm(1”),
30mm(1-3/16”), 31mm(1-7/32”) |

Q.: |
In what applications does InteCel perform best? |
|
A.: |
InteCel is an excellent wood substitute for MDO, HDO, plywood
and lumber in general in the following application: Substrate for
signs and lamination. Fabrication of exhibits and POP displays.
Fabrication of trim, soffits and fascia boards. Fabrication of
furniture and cabinets. Fabrication of door panels and bay windows.
Fabrication of items in marine applications. |
| |
|
|
Q.: |
How does moisture affects InteCel? |
|
A.: |
InteCel’s closed-cell structure makes it impervious to moisture
that causes swelling, rot and delamination in lumber and paper
products. |
| |
|
|
Q.: |
Is priming or any kind of surface preparation required with InteCel? |
|
A.: |
None, other than cleaning before painting, gluing or laminating. |

Q.: |
How does extreme temperatures affect InteCel? |
|
A.: |
As with any thermoplastic, InteCel will become harder or softer
with swings in temperature and direct exposure to sunlight. This may
cause some deflection. Please follow the Usage and Fabrication
Guidelines, available at your distributor, for proper installation
procedures. |
| |
|
|
Q.: |
What types of paints or inks work best with InteCel? |
|
A.: |
Polyurethane or solvent-based paints or inks. |
| |
|
|
Q.: |
Can InteCel be easily glued? |
|
A.: |
Yes. Epoxy or PVC glues work best. |
| |
|
|
Q.: |
Is InteCel fire rated? |
|
A.: |
Yes. It conforms to UL94 V0, UL94 5V and UL48. |
| |
|
|
Q.: |
Is InteCel environmentally safe? |
|
A.: |
Yes. It contains no lead or heavy metals and is recyclable. |
